How can you improve your skills without paying for expensive courses?

1. Tap Into Free Online Resources

  • YouTube: There’s a tutorial for nearly everything, from coding to cooking to public speaking, often made by passionate experts.
  • Podcasts & Blogs: Many professionals share insights and tips for free. Find a few favorites in your field and tune in regularly.
  • OpenCourseWare: Universities like MIT and Harvard offer free course materials and lectures online—check out platforms like edX and Coursera (many have free audit options).

2. Use Public Libraries

  • Libraries aren’t just for books; many offer free workshops, access to online learning platforms (like Lynda/LinkedIn Learning), and even software you might need.

3. Practice, Practice, Practice

  • Improvement often comes from doing, not just watching. Set small challenges for yourself: write a short story, build a basic website, cook a new recipe, or record yourself presenting.

4. Join Online Communities & Forums

  • Sites like Reddit, Stack Overflow, or even Facebook Groups are filled with people sharing advice, answering questions, and sometimes offering mentorship opportunities.
  • Get active—ask questions, try challenges, and learn from others’ experiences.

5. Volunteer or Intern

  • Look for local nonprofits, community groups, or startups where you can offer your time in exchange for real-world experience. You’ll build your skills and your network at the same time.

6. Peer Learning and Skill Swaps

  • Team up with friends or colleagues who want to learn something you know, and vice versa. Trade knowledge—it’s motivating and social!

7. Free Trials & Demos

  • Many paid platforms offer free trials. Use them strategically—set a goal or project to complete within your trial period to maximize learning.

8. Public Challenges and Hackathons

  • Join writing contests, coding hackathons, art challenges, or whatever fits your interest. These events push you to grow, often with feedback from peers.

9. Read Widely

  • Books, articles, and even newsletters in your field can deepen your knowledge. Many classics or foundational texts are available for free online (try Project Gutenberg or your local library’s e-book collection).

10. Reflect & Track Progress

  • Keep a journal or portfolio of your work. Looking back on how far you’ve come is motivating—and helps you see what to focus on next.
